Recombinant Mouse Kitl protein, His-tagged, Biotinylated.

Cat.No. : Kitl-577M
Product Overview : Recombinant Mouse Kitl(Lys 26 - Ala 189) fused with His tag at C-terminal was expressed in HEK293, Biotinylated.
  • Specification
  • Gene Information
  • Related Products
Source : HEK293
Species : Mouse
Tag : His
Predicted N Terminal : Lys 26
Form : Lyophilized from 0.22µm filtered solution in PBS (pH 7.4) with Trehalose as protectant.
Molecular Mass : Has a calculated MW of 19.1 kDa. The protein migrates as 19-30 kDa on a SDS-PAGE gel under reducing (R) condition due to different glycosylation.
Protein length : Lys 26 - Ala 189
Endotoxin : Less than 1.0 EU per μg by the LAL method.
Purity : >98% as determined by SDS-PAGE.
Storage : For long term storage, the product should be stored at lyophilized state at -20 centigrade or lower. Please avoid repeated freeze-thaw cycles.No activity loss is observed after storage at:4-8 centigrade for 12 months in lyophilized state;-70 centigrade for 3 months under sterile conditions after reconstitution.
Reconstitution : Reconstitute at 100 μg/mL in sterile deionized water. For best performance, we strongly recommend you to follow the reconstitution protocol provided in the COA.
Gene Name : Kitl kit ligand [ Mus musculus ]
Official Symbol : Kitl
Synonyms : KITL; kit ligand; cloud gray; C-kit ligand; Steel factor; grizzle-belly; stem cell factor; mast cell growth factor; hematopoietic growth factor KL; Gb; SF; Sl; Clo; Con; Mgf; SCF; SLF; Kitlg; contrasted;
Gene ID : 17311
mRNA Refseq : NM_013598
Protein Refseq : NP_038626
UniProt ID : P20826
Chromosome Location : 10 D1; 10 51.4 cM
Pathway : Cytokine-cytokine receptor interaction, organism-specific biosystem; Cytokine-cytokine receptor interaction, conserved biosystem; Hematopoietic cell lineage, organism-specific biosystem; Hematopoietic cell lineage, conserved biosystem; Kit Receptor Signaling Pathway, organism-specific biosystem; Melanogenesis, organism-specific biosystem; Melanogenesis, conserved biosystem;
Function : cytokine activity; growth factor activity; protein binding; stem cell factor receptor binding;
